[1.79.3] Начиная с данной сборки УБУ, для кореектной работы МСЕ теперь требуется Python v3.7 или вышг. Также следует установить 2 библиотеки: - pip install colorama - pip install pltable
[1,75] Куча нововведений в папках Интел [1,72] MMTool К сожалению, невозможно предугадать какой муму отработает корректно. Поэтому используйте 2 разные версии мумутула - 5.0.0.7 как "mmtool_a4.exe" и 5.2.0.2x+ как "mmtool_a5.exe" Использование только одной версии не пригодно для многих бивисов на Aptio. [1.71] VROC Для обновления VROC with VMD требуется 2 файла, пример в папке Intel\VROC Штатные файлы RAID и sSATA укладываются, как обычно, в папку RSTe. MMTool Заложена поддержка 2-ух различных версий MMTool на перспективу. На данный момент используется одна версия, рекомендуется 5.0.0.7. Переименовать как "mmtool_a4.exe"
[1.70] IRST/IRST(e) Начиная с версии 1.70 пользователь самостоятельно подбирает нужные версии файлов для создания RAID массивов.
1) В послденее время опять участились жалобы на наличии вируса в пакете UBU, якобы МСЕ,ехе содержит вирус. Поэтому принято решение, что вместо ехе файла теперь будет py исхотдный Пайтона. Чтобы была корректная работа с микодами вам необходимо установить пакет Ptyhon версии 3.7 или выше. А также две библиотеки: - colorama - PLTable Как это сделать уаказано на ГитХабе в репе МСЕ. Вы можете юзать м ехе файл, но скачивать его будете самостоятельно. Если установите Пайтон то у вас появится возможность юзать другие приложения на Пайтон, которых очень много. 2) Все архивы с файлами теперь здесь https://mega.nz/#F!MSRDxSqR!5etS-te7ZqRQX9Zb25es_A 3) На данный момент рекомендуется использовать UEFITool v0.25.0 (и не выше), до выяснения
Соблюдайте Правила конференции и используйте поиск по теме. Мешающие чтению картинки и видео убирайте под спойлер. Сообщения с избыточным цитированием могут исправляться или удаляться без уведомления их авторов.
Последний раз редактировалось DeathBringer 28.01.2024 11:28, всего редактировалось 1026 раз(а).
Куратор темы Статус: Не в сети Регистрация: 20.04.2012 Откуда: Россия
svarmod, в данном случае нет, тк нет коекретных указателей какую именно надо менять.
Добавлено спустя 24 минуты 43 секунды: Кстати! А хорошо, что поинтересовался! Сразу появилась идея о расширении функционала для Репллейсера и Экстрактора. Суть ее:
Member
Статус: Не в сети Регистрация: 02.05.2015 Откуда: Москва Фото: 8
LS_29 Идея хорошая, очень не хватает такой функции. Боюсь только ее добавление займет порядочно времени. Может найдется другой способ для реализации задуманного из командной строки? Например, возможно ли корректно пересобрать такой GUID из рипнутых body и заменить его полностью?
Куратор темы Статус: Не в сети Регистрация: 20.04.2012 Откуда: Россия
svarmod. уже думал, но откровенно говоря геморойно. 1) Извлекаем содержимое в папку 2) for /f dir /b формируем текстовый список извлеченных файов 3) патчим, что там надо, но главное, чтобы список не нарушался 3) for /f по списоку генерим RAW файлы с той же нумерацией в другую папку 4) for /f dir /b создаем список уже с RAW 5) for /f список RAW заталкивем в переменную, аналогично как это делает UBU для микодов 6) генерим FFS и обратно в биос
Есть еще пара вопросов: - При таком способе не возникнет проблем с какими-либо указателями? - Какая-то утилита умеет генерить RAW секции? Я пока только придумал скриптом пересчитывать размер и добавлять нужное - вроде работает. - При генерации в genffs понадобятся какие-то доп. флаги, или достаточно -t -g -i?
Есть еще пара вопросов: - При таком способе не возникнет проблем с какими-либо указателями?
Если только в том же GUID не окажется файлов отличных от RAW
Цитата:
- Какая-то утилита умеет генерить RAW секции? Я пока только придумал скриптом пересчитывать размер и добавлять нужное - вроде работает.
GenSec
Цитата:
- При генерации в genffs понадобятся какие-то доп. флаги, или достаточно -t -g -i?
Вообще для начала надо повытаскивать все файлы как естьэ У RAW смотреть нужна ли CS не только загодовка, те оффсет 0х17 != АА Для FFS уже надо смотреть в тип секции.
А вообще, менять, что то надо в одном файле RAW или в несколькох? Если только в одном, то UEFUPatch в помощь. Хотя под одним GUID и в нескольких RAW должно получиться через UEFIPatch
Member
Статус: Не в сети Регистрация: 02.05.2015 Откуда: Москва Фото: 8
LS_29 писал(а):
по моему как раз по твоей затее
Видел. Та прога, к сожалению, абсолютно не унифицирована и сильно косячная. У меня хотя бы весь заявленный функционал работает и антивир не орет.) Да и делать я свою начал раньше, просто из-за отсутствия опыта приходится во всем разбираться по ходу. В любом случае хочется завершить начатое.
LS_29 писал(а):
GenSec
Ага, результат совпадает с тем что было собрано у меня.
А зачем рипать чтобы посмотреть оффсет? Разве в UEFITool DataChecksum не то, что нужно? Я так понимаю если значение не AA, то в genffs будет необходим ключ -s? Менять нужно довольно много и в разных RAW'ах, в основном добавлять. UEFIPatch не будет удобен на мой взгляд, и он не очень хорошо зарекомендовал себя: как-то вместо патча 1 байта перестроил кучу всего вдобавок. Да и все равно там нужно дизассемблером пройтись.
В целом вроде разобрался, большое спасибо! Все генерится, реплейсится, проги не ругаются, при повторном извлечении секции выглядят как надо. Осталось доделать сами патчи и можно будет кирпичиться. )
LS_29 писал(а):
...китайцы...
Так-то я тоже кое-что из UBU позаимствовал, но в основном использовал как учебник. Все благодарочки честно указаны в ченджлоге. )
Куратор темы Статус: Не в сети Регистрация: 20.04.2012 Откуда: Россия
svarmod, да ладно, мне не жалко, код то всё равно на виду, Лады, дераай. Кстати, если патчер будет заменять микоды и/или любые файлы в PEI томах, то юзать только иуиутул, УР и УТ с PEI томами плохо работают, кирпич гарантирован на многих биосах. И на асусах к тому же 2 PEI тома, тут смотри как в бантике сделано обновление микодов.
Member
Статус: Не в сети Регистрация: 26.12.2009 Откуда: Украина
Mov AX _ 0xDEAD писал(а):
godmode в биосе ?
да)) как я понял у HP такое практикуется, в инэте находил вариант ctrl+a, ctrl+f10, ctrl+f11. Вот и возникла мысль, что где-то в биосе эта комбинация задана, и было бы хорошо её узнать, может и разгон откроется.
Куратор темы Статус: Не в сети Регистрация: 11.12.2010 Фото: 13
Привет, друзья.
Помогите впарить в биос микод, который хочу. LGA1155, 3770K (Ivy), нужон 19-й (который с лучшим разгоном). Принял взвешенное решение, что Спектро-лабуда пойдёт у меня лесом, вдоль опушки. Мельдауна оставлю, пусть бегает. Помнится, что он вроде тормоза не создаёт.
Выколупал от старого UBU "cpu000306A9_plat12_ver00000019_date13-06-2013.bin" - это ж оно? Не знаю как его назвать правильно в новом формате линейки UBU v1.70. Не пойму что в названии такое после "..._PRD_..." Ну и строчку нужно правильно прописать в файле "MCUpdate.txt". По счёту, выходит, второй сверху в разделе #LGA1155. Правильно всё понял?
Как 19-й жёстко в UBU поставить, чтоб работал только он? (С блокировкой "mcupdate_GenuineIntel.dll", есс-но). Тогда не использовать встроенный в UBU "MCUpdate.txt", а заменить его на свой, с 1-м (19-м) микодом? В этом случае в меню UBU сразу жать [M] User Select only 1 Microcode file?
Отстал от жизни, сориентируйте, плз.
P.S. Ну, и по правилам хорошего тона надо 28-й для Санди тоже прошить (хотя и проца этого у меня нет). (Чисто для комильфо, типа как на продажу).
Куратор темы Статус: Не в сети Регистрация: 20.04.2012 Откуда: Россия
ingviowarr Бепешь нужный файл микода, кидаешь в папку 1155 как есть. В тексткльке находищь CPUID 306А9 и напротив правишь "1155\имя твоего файла", Или оключаешь оригинал строки значком # и добавляешь свою 306А9 1155\имя своего файла. Аналогично для Сэнди.
Куратор темы Статус: Не в сети Регистрация: 20.04.2012 Откуда: Россия
Voyager777 писал(а):
mmtool, в разделе CPU patch можно грохнуть всё что есть и добавить только нужный микрокод
На аптии 4 такие фокусы ге проходят просто так.
Добавлено спустя 2 минуты 46 секунд:
ingviowarr писал(а):
А UBU очищать набор микодов не умеет из шаблона-исходника заводского бивиса?Только предоставляет и заменяет на некий набор "свежих" ?Я так понял, просто закоментить другие микоды смысла не имеет? Тогда останутся старые, из заводского бивиса, и один тот, что сам запихну?
Поэксперементируй и узнаешь. Всё равно сразу втюхивать не будет, сначала покажет, что втюхает.
Куратор темы Статус: Не в сети Регистрация: 11.12.2010 Фото: 13
LS_29 писал(а):
Поэксперементируй и узнаешь.
Супер. Вроде получается. Значит UBU может очищать заводской список и оставлять только то, что нужно. Респект! Зачистил все *.bin -ы по пути ...\mCode\1155\ , а в "MCUpdate.txt" в разделе #LGA1155 закомментил всё, кроме своей подстановки. После применения по команде [C] перевход по П.5 меню показывает в таблице микодов только то, что мне требуется, остального нет. Чудно.
Ещё один вопрос. С точки зрения общей работоспособности, если хотя бы один микод присутствует (хоть и морально устаревший), нынешняя Win10 будет фурычить по-любому, при любых раскладах (если софтовую подстановку в ОС заблочить)? А то они там в интелях-мелкософтах сча такое гонют, что аж носки спадают. Устроили Санта-Барбару с этим Спектром, короче, "вышел из зала посредине промтотра".
А то они там в интелях-мелкософтах сча такое гонют, что аж носки спадают.
даже не меняя микрокод, поведение ядра винды уже изменено, в реестре есть опции "отключения", но насколько все вернулось к тому что было раньше знают только в MS
Куратор темы Статус: Не в сети Регистрация: 20.04.2012 Откуда: Россия
svarmod, по твоей задаче есть такая идея. При сборке FFS надо указывать последовательно входные файлы
Код:
-i file_1 -i file_2 и тд
но можно еще сделать и так
Код:
сcpy /b file_1+file_2 file_full в GenFFS уже -i file_full
правда тоже есть свой недостаток, но всё решаемо.
Добавлено спустя 3 минуты 1 секунду: ingviowarr, в этом вся прелесть, что можно убрать всё, а можно и подхимичить, те добавить то чего нет. Да и редактировать список можно прямо из UBU На счет винды 10 не знаю.
Добавлено спустя 5 минут 55 секунд:
Voyager777 писал(а):
А чем чревато?
, тут свои нюансы. Обычно в бивисах по 2 файла, а то и больше, один "пустышка" остальные уже контейнеры с микодами. Так вот если юзать муму 4.50 то из за этой "пустышки" идет падение утили. Если юзать муму 5, то падежа нет, но в контейнерах с микодами обязательно должна быть секция MPDT. Без нее муму не фурычит во вкладке микодов. А на первых бивисах этой секции в болшинстве своем - немась. Она начала появляться на 8-ой серии и последних бивисах для х79.
Сейчас этот форум просматривают: felix007, Google [Bot], jetgrach и гости: 38
Вы не можете начинать темы Вы не можете отвечать на сообщения Вы не можете редактировать свои сообщения Вы не можете удалять свои сообщения Вы не можете добавлять вложения